Subject: [PATCH 7/6] ds: remove PLCMap and per-socket PostLoopCallback

We don't need and won't be needing per-socket PostLoopCallbacks.
---
lib/PublicInbox/DS.pm | 25 ++-----------------------
1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 23 deletions(-)
diff --git a/lib/PublicInbox/DS.pm b/lib/PublicInbox/DS.pm
index 6b04e76..03612ce 100644
--- a/lib/PublicInbox/DS.pm
+++ b/lib/PublicInbox/DS.pm
@@ -58,7 +58,6 @@ our (
@ToClose, # sockets to close when event loop is done
$PostLoopCallback, # subref to call at the end of each loop, if defined (global)
- %PLCMap, # fd (num) -> PostLoopCallback (per-object)
$LoopTimeout, # timeout of event loop in milliseconds
$DoneInit, # if we've done the one-time module init yet
@@ -85,7 +84,6 @@ sub Reset {
@Timers = ();
$PostLoopCallback = undef;
- %PLCMap = ();
$DoneInit = 0;
# NOTE kqueue is close-on-fork, and we don't account for it, yet
@@ -389,18 +387,8 @@ The callback function will be passed two parameters: \%DescriptorMap
sub SetPostLoopCallback {
my ($class, $ref) = @_;
- if (ref $class) {
- # per-object callback
- my PublicInbox::DS $self = $class;
- if (defined $ref && ref $ref eq 'CODE') {
- $PLCMap{$self->{fd}} = $ref;
- } else {
- delete $PLCMap{$self->{fd}};
- }
- } else {
- # global callback
- $PostLoopCallback = (defined $ref && ref $ref eq 'CODE') ? $ref : undef;
- }
+ # global callback
+ $PostLoopCallback = (defined $ref && ref $ref eq 'CODE') ? $ref : undef;
}
# Internal function: run the post-event callback, send read events
@@ -426,11 +414,6 @@ sub PostEventLoop {
# or global) cancels it
my $keep_running = 1;
- # per-object post-loop-callbacks
- for my $plc (values %PLCMap) {
- $keep_running &&= $plc->(\%DescriptorMap);
- }
-
# now we're at the very end, call callback if defined
if (defined $PostLoopCallback) {
$keep_running &&= $PostLoopCallback->(\%DescriptorMap);
@@ -580,10 +563,6 @@ sub _cleanup {
}
}
- # now delete from mappings. this fd no longer belongs to us, so we don't want
- # to get alerts for it if it becomes writable/readable/etc.
- delete $PLCMap{$self->{fd}};
-
# we explicitly don't delete from DescriptorMap here until we
# actually close the socket, as we might be in the middle of
# processing an epoll_wait/etc that returned hundreds of fds, one
